    Some stuff I noted:

    Discover --> TrialPay --> William Hill --> 1400 SB
    Discover --> Kiwi Wall --> William Hill --> 3400 SB
    (Minimum deposit of £10 at both but the difference is huge)

    Discover --> OfferToro --> Telfie --> 7 SB --> Very easy offer, if you haven't done it yet - go for it.
